Method 3: Use Calibre Software
Calibre is the most powerful open-source ebook management software that also supports web scraping.
Installation and Setup
- Download and install Calibre from the official website
- Open the software, click "Add books"
- Select "Add from URL"
Scraping a Single Web Page
1. Copy the target URL
2. In Calibre, select Add books > Add from URL
3. Paste the URL and confirm
4. Calibre will automatically download and convert to EPUB
Scraping Entire Websites/Article Series
Calibre also supports batch scraping using the "News download" feature:
- Click "Fetch news"
- Add custom news source
- Configure scraping rules (CSS selectors, etc.)
- Schedule or manually fetch

Method 4: Command Line Tools
For technical users, command line tools offer maximum flexibility.
Pandoc
Pandoc is a universal document converter:
# Convert web page to EPUB
pandoc -f html -t epub3 https://example.com/article -o output.epub
# Add metadata
pandoc -f html -t epub3 \
--metadata title="Article Title" \
--metadata author="Author" \
https://example.com/article -o output.epub
Percollate
Percollate is specifically designed for converting web pages to ebooks:
# Install
npm install -g percollate
# Convert single web page
percollate epub https://example.com/article -o book.epub
# Convert multiple pages into one book
percollate epub \
https://example.com/chapter1 \
https://example.com/chapter2 \
https://example.com/chapter3 \
-o complete-book.epub
Advantages
- Suitable for automation and batch processing
- Can be integrated into workflows
- Highly customizable

Q2: Images from the web page weren't saved?
Possible causes:
- Images use lazy loading
- Images have hotlink protection
- Conversion tool doesn't support certain image formats
Solutions:
- Scroll to load all images in browser first
- Use SingleFile extension to save complete page
- Manually download images and add to EPUB

Q5: Can I read the converted file on Kindle?
Yes! Two ways:
- New Kindle devices (2022+) directly support EPUB
- Older Kindles need conversion to MOBI format first
